Episode 1: Vici Wreford-Sinnott, Punk Activist and Theatre-Maker

Hartlepool-born writer, director and Disability rights activist Vici talks about discovering counter-culture while growing up in a pit village in the East Durham coalfield. She shares her memories of moving to London where “the streets were paved with punk”, her love of bands including New Model Army and Spear Of Destiny, and of being inspired by the DIY ethos of the movement.  Vici talks about the evolution of her career as a theatre-maker. She recalls her award-winning work in the Republic of Ireland, her part in holding one of the first disability arts festivals, and her decision to return to the north-east to make work that reflects the lives of her and her friends, including her 2025 production ‘Unruly’.  Vici talks about her conditions, mental and physical, about the urgent challenges facing Disabled people in Britain today, and the political necessity of being a Disability Rights Activist.  She discusses society’s obsession with perfection, the good and the bad in the high-profile media surrounding the London 2012 Paralympics, and how the struggle for equity continues. She also pays homage to her fellow travellers, and some of the many trailblazers and inspirational figures in the disabled arts world.  Interviewed by Claire Raftery. Audio Mastered by Barry Han. Episode 2: Christine Sketchley, Educational Psychologist

On 2nd August 1990, in the lead-up to the first Gulf War, British Airways flight 149 was grounded in Kuwait. Christine was on-board that flight, and was one of 385 passengers and crew taken hostage by the Iraqi military. She describes how that life-changing experience has informed her practice as an educational psychologist dedicated to improving children’s lives.     The innovator behind the revolutionary Adults First system, Christine talks about growing up in Manchester, her childhood and education, and the influence of the rock band The Doors in choosing psychology as a career path. A 20-year resident of Norton in Stockton-on-Tees, Christine describes her innovative methods which are inspired by animal psychology and seek to empower parent-carers to effect positive change for young people.   Interviewed by Claire Raftery, Audio Mastered by Barry Han. Episode 3: Amy Walton and Kelly Ensbury, Founders of Urban Kaos

Now celebrating their 20th year, Urban Kaos Dance Company is led by Stockton-based founders Amy and Kelly. They recall their life-long dancing careers and the evolution of the company - from their rebellion against the body perfectionism of professional dance to forming their own ethos where movement is for everyone.    They talk about their work which has reached thousands of people of all sizes, shapes, ages and backgrounds, including in community centres and schools, with an asylum support group and in Young Offenders Centres. They speak about their award-winning company and how they turned down Dragon’s Den - because they’re not franchiseable. And all of this born from the night they saw a field full of unicorns just off the A1.   Interview by Lynne Lawson. Audio Mastered by Barry Han. Edited by Damian Wright. Episode 4: Jennifer Yuill, Activist for the 'No More Page 3' Campaign

10 years ago, the ‘No More Page 3’ campaign finally achieved its goal of removing the regular photographic feature of topless female models shown on Page 3 of The Sun, a self-proclaimed family newspaper.  Hartlepool native Jennifer Yuill was one of the core activists in that movement and recalls her fellow campaigners, the strategies and techniques they deployed, battling with online trolls, and how it felt to succeed in their goal. She talks about the ongoing friendships she made in the movement, her commitment to tackling sexism in the media, and her current work with the Youth Justice Board. Jennifer is an educator and co-founder of Woman Up!, a charity that raises the voices of marginalised, underrepresented and vulnerable women.  Interviewed by Vicky Jackson. Episode 5: Ella Brewster, Elite Rugby Player & Artist

Artist, film-maker and professional rugby player Ella describes her journey to the top domestic levels of the sport, from a childhood in Darlington when she was the only girl on the pitch, to playing with some of the best rugby players in the world.   She talks about the camaraderie and friendships born from rugby culture, highlighting the body positivity it encourages and how there’s a place for every size and shape. She also discusses the challenges, from pre-match nerves to injuries and funding cuts. Ella describes her cultural career, inspired by her artist parents Lee and Jill Brewster, and how she’s balanced working creatively at ARC Stockton, Generator North-East and recently the BBC with training and playing rugby at the highest level.   Interviewed by Claire Raftery.
